摘要
In this brief, we present an estimator of the parameters of the Hindmarsh-Rose model using an adaptive observer. This estimator allows us to distinguish the firing patterns with early-time dynamic behaviors. The MATLAB simulations demonstrate the estimation performance of the proposed adaptive observer.
